Anyway, I thought to share this one gem with you – mainly because it was playing in my head the whole trip. It’s early Chicago house rarity from Joe Lewis and just perfect tune for summer. Gotta love those little snare fills and cowbells! I think the vinyl goes for something like 100-200 euros on Ebay, so good luck with that one.

Eagle Boston is totally cool german/finnish ensemble. Apparently the band was formed while mixing the LCMDF album in the Kaiku studios in Berlin. From what I’ve heard, the girls were late and the dudes just started jamming, and the next thing you know, there’s a new band. They combine elements from kraut, new wave and traditional pop music, I really love that there’s people pushing this kind of sound… And doing it well too! The band is making waves in the States already (I heard “Satan Highway” on EVR (pretty much the coolest netradio out there), so be on the lookout, they might go places.
